BLESS fluctuated 40.8% in 24 hours: trading volume surged 117%, driving price rebound
Bitget Pulse2026/04/12 04:36Volatility Overview
In the past 24 hours, BLESS price rebounded from a low of $0.0062747 to a high/current price of $0.0088343, reflecting a fluctuation of 40.8%. 24-hour trading volume reached $5.44 million, a surge of 117.6% compared to the previous day; market cap is approximately $14.07 million, with clear signs of net capital inflow.
